The Department of Health Sciences includes the subjects Oral Health, Nursing, Public Health Science and Medical Science. The department has an important role in the education of students within the Nursing Programme, the programmes in Specialist Nursing and the Master’s Programme in Health Science, as well as offering freestanding courses in nursing, public health science and medical science. As of the autumn term 2020, the new three-year Dental Hygienist Programme opens with the aim of becoming one of the best study programmes in the country and thereby contribute to the competence maintenance of dental hygienist in Sweden. It is a modified campus programme where digital distance learning is combined with examinations and clinical training on campus, as well as placements in different parts of the country. Together with the department’s health science subjects, we promote joint development of research and education within the field of health. For doctoral students within the field, the faculty offers a research education environment, the Graduate School of Health. The department has close and fruitful co-operation with Region Värmland. In collaboration with Folktandvården Region Värmland, we will within the near future set up Sweden’s fist academic public dental service clinic (AFK) in Karlstad. AFK is located in immediate proximity to the university and creates great opportunities for development and collaboration within education and research.
Research in the subject aims to apply a salutogenic perspective, which means that it is characterised by the importance of health factors for oral health within different social groups and during the entire life cycle. The profile field of oral health is based on a public health perspective and promotes interdisciplinary collaboration at both local, national and international level. We offer a unique opportunity to be a part of a research group with great visions for the future of research that is represented by highly topical areas within oral health, such as epidemiology, public health and paediatric dentistry and gerodontics.
